James L. Todd, born on Oct. 15, 1964 in Marinette County, WI, passed away unexpectedly on Dec. 6, 2020 at Froedtert Hospital in Wauwatosa, WI. Jim is survived by his loving wife, Victoria (nee Van Ryzin), his dear children Zackary, Crystal and Jared and his fond parents, Ilene (nee Charlson) and Carl Hosterman. He is the brother of Denise (Mike) Mayer and Jeff Todd, the son-in-law of Donna and Ronald Van Ryzin, the brother-in-law of Tracey Van Ryzin and Tim Van Ryzin, the uncle of Nicole (Kevin) Waller, Kirsten and Maddie Van Ryzin and Amanda Kostansek and the great-uncle of Huxley Waller. Jim is further survived by other relatives and many friends.
Jim's greatest joy was watching all three of his kids play hockey. For 23 years he was a part of the Ozaukee Ice Dogs and worked the bench for many of those years. If he wasn't at the rink, he would be watching hockey on TV when not watching the Packers. He also coached little league, was a boy scout leader, bowled his entire life and was proud of his 300 game, golfed with his buddies, and he had a love of the outdoors that included camping with friends and old classmates, hiking, rafting and playing games. Known for his ability to fix anything, Jim was great at jerry rigging things when parts were not available, and he loved to tackle any home remodeling project. Jim was a hard worker, first working at EST Company, then Waste Management, following that at Spiro and lastly at Miller Bakery. He will truly be missed by many.
Due to the Covid-19 pandemic, no public services will be held at this time. Jelacic Funeral Home (414-466-2134) assisting the family.
